Spring Energy and Immunity: Why It Matters

Spring is a time of renewal and rising energy in nature. However, this season also brings about changes for cats. Factors such as fluctuating weather, increased allergens, and the start of shedding season can challenge a cat's immune system. This is precisely where proper nutrition and supportive supplements come into play.

Considerations and Veterinary Advice

While these superfoods and supplements are beneficial for your cat's health, always remember to consult your veterinarian. Determining the most suitable products and dosages based on your cat's age, overall health, existing conditions, and other medications is critically important.
